From b45819dd97c39dcded6f2fb50c297aeb5d15e035 Mon Sep 17 00:00:00 2001
From: Andrew Tridgell <tridge@samba.org>
Date: Wed, 9 Apr 2014 14:30:27 +1000
Subject: [PATCH] AntennaTracker: don't use EEPROM home if a startup home is
 set in parameters

---
 Tools/AntennaTracker/system.pde |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/Tools/AntennaTracker/system.pde b/Tools/AntennaTracker/system.pde
index 03c6be0ae..75ea860f1 100644
--- a/Tools/AntennaTracker/system.pde
+++ b/Tools/AntennaTracker/system.pde
@@ -83,7 +83,9 @@ static void init_tracker()
     current_loc.lng = g.start_longitude * 1.0e7f;
 
     // see if EEPROM has a default location as well
-    get_home_eeprom(current_loc);
+    if (current_loc.lat == 0 && current_loc.lng == 0) {
+        get_home_eeprom(current_loc);
+    }
 
     gcs_send_text_P(SEVERITY_LOW,PSTR("\nReady to track."));
     hal.scheduler->delay(1000); // Why????
-- 
GitLab